Annual events worth planning around

Milano Design Week

A citywide design calendar each April, with installations, showrooms, and events across Milan.

Milano Marathon

A spring road race each April, drawing runners through central streets and neighborhood routes.

Milano Fashion Week

A biannual runway season in February and September, centered on shows, presentations, and industry events.

Artigiano in Fiera

A major artisan fair each December, gathering makers, foods, and crafts under one roof.
